Transponder Key Services
Transponder keys are a security feature in numerous modern lorries. These keys have an embedded chip that interacts with the car's computer to enable it to begin. A locksmith can program and replace these keys, maintaining the security of your vehicle.

Q: How long does it require to get a brand-new key made?
A: The time it requires to make a new key can vary depending upon the type of key and the intricacy of the vehicle's lock system. Easy key duplications can take just a couple of minutes, while programming a transponder key may take longer, typically 30 minutes to an hour.

Q: Is it legal to have a locksmith make a duplicate key without the original?
A: The legality of making a duplicate key without the original can vary by place. In many locations, locksmith professionals are required to validate ownership or have actually a signed authorization before developing a new key.
